The USB 3.0 port maxes out at up 300 MB/s (megabytes per second). The USB 3.0 port is also backwards compatible with USB 2.0 and USB 1.1, but their speeds will be noticeably slower, since they are older technologies. The eSATA port also offers a maximum data-transfer rate of up to 300 MB/s. The dual FireWire 800 ports are not too far behind, with a maximum data-transfer rate of up to 100 MB/s per port. The FireWire 800 ports also support FireWire 400, but you’ll need to purchase the FireWire 400-to-FireWire 800 adapter separately.
The Mercury Elite Pro features a compact, shock-resistant design. While OWC states that the Mercury Elite Pro was created with the Mac Pro computer in mind, the stylish enclosure will work well with any computer. The aluminum enclosure features a drive bay that can hold a 3.5” SATA hard drive. Compatible with SATA I, II and III hard drives, the Mercury Elite Pro allows you to install a hard drive with a maximum capacity of up to 4TB. If you would like to use a 2.5” SATA drive, a common form factor for solid-state drives, you’ll need to purchase the AdapatDrive from OWC separately in order for the 2.5” drive to fit into the enclosure.
The Mercury Elite Pro 1-Bay Storage Kit may not come with a hard drive, but it comes with cables and a stand to help you get started as soon as you install one. There’s a 3’ eSATA-to-eSATA connecting cable, a 3’ FireWire 800 9-pin-to-9-pin connecting cable and a 3’ USB 3.0 Standard B-to-Standard A connecting cable. A vertical stand is also included for keeping your Mercury Elite Pro in an upright position for easy access to the ports.
The Mercury Elite Pro is compatible with both Mac and Windows computers. However, please be aware that you will be required to reformat each time you switch operating systems. The Mercury Elite Pro also comes with a 1-year limited parts and labor warranty.
Material | Brushed aluminum |
Chipset | Oxford 944 and Oxford 3100 eSATA/FireWire/USB chipset |
Drive Types Supported | Type: SATA I/II/III Max. Size: 4TB |
Drive Bays | 1 |
Port Configuration | 1 x USB 3.0 (Standard B port) 2 x FireWire 800 (9-pin port) 1 x eSATA |
Maximum Data Rate | USB 3.0: up to 300 MB/s USB 2.0: up to 60 MB/s USB 1.1: up to 1.5 MB/s FireWire 800: up to 100 MB/s FireWire 400 (800 to 400 adapter required): up to 50 MB/s eSATA: up to 300 MB/s |
Windows System Requirements | USB 3.0: Windows XP and later with USB 3.0 interface, either built in or via USB 3.0 expander card USB 2.0: Windows 2000 or later with USB 2.0 interface, either built in or via USB 2.0 expander card FireWire 800: Windows 2000 and later with FireWire 800 interface, either built in or via FireWire 800 expander card FireWire 400 (800 to 400 adapter required): Windows 2000 and later with FireWire 400 interface, either built in via FireWire 400 expander card eSATA: Windows 2000 and later with eSATA interface, either built in or via eSATA expander card |
Mac System Requirements | Mac OS 8.6 to 9.2.2 compatible, OS X 10.1.x and later. Including Lion 10.7.x (10.2 or later required for FW800 and USB 2.0) USB 3.0: Mac with USB 3.0 interface, either built in or via USB 3.0 expander card USB 2.0: Mac with USB 2.0 interface, either built in or via USB 2.0 expander card FireWire 800: Mac with FireWire 800 interface, either built in or via FireWire 800 expander card FireWire 400 (800 to 400 adapter required): Mac with FireWire 400 interface, either built in or via FireWire 400 expander card eSATA: Mac with eSATA interface, either built in or via eSATA expander card Time Machine: Mac OS X 10.5 (version introduced) and later |
Linux Requirements | Linux compatible via supported USB and FireWire interfaces |
Recommended eSATA Cards* | eSATA Extender Cables for Mac Pro: Newer Technology eSATA Extender Cable Adapter PCIe (PCI Express) for Desktops: NewerTech MAXPower 6G eSATA RAID card with port multiplier Firmtek Seritek/2SE2-E PCI Express eSATA card DAT Optic PCIe 8x 4 Channel eSATA Card HighPoint RocketRAID 2314 PCI-Express eSATA Card |
Operating Environment | Varies depending on drive mechanism installed (temperature, relative humidity, shock, vibration, MTBF/hours) |
Power Supply | AC 100 - 240 V, 50/60 Hz (3A) - US/international power supply (auto-switching) |
Dimensions | 1.5 x 4.6 x 9.0" / 3.8 x 11.7 x 22.9 cm |
